Chinese Coleslaw

Prep time: 5 minutes

Cook time: 5 minutes

Active time: 5 minutes

Total time: 15 minutes

Yield: 10-12 servings

Ingredients:

1 cup silvered almonds, lightly toasted

¼ cup sesame seeds, lightly toasted

2 (14-ounce) bags classic coleslaw (about 9 cups) (substitute- shredded cabbage)

6 scallions, finely chopped

1 ½ cups honey roasted peanuts

4 packages Oriental flavor Ramen soup mix (substitute- original flavor)

1 cup white vinegar

½ cup sugar

1 1/3 cup vegetable oil

Directions:

Preheat oven to 350°F degrees. On a baking sheet with parchment paper or aluminum foil, toast almonds until lightly golden brown, about 3-4 minutes. Set aside. On the same baking sheet, toast sesame seeds, until lightly golden brown, about 2-3 minutes. Set aside.

Using a mallet or back of a spoon, crumble up noodles (from soup mix) into small pieces. Set aside.

In a large bowl, mix together toasted almonds, toasted sesame seeds, shredded coleslaw, scallions, peanuts, and crushed noodles. Set aside.

In a small bowl, whisk together oriental flavor ramen soup powder mix, vinegar, and sugar. Slowly whisk in vegetable oil until emulsified. Pour dressing over salad and mix together until fully dressed.
